ComputersProgrammering

Algoritme - een goed gedefinieerde reeks wiskundige bewerkingen

Computer Computer Engineering is gebaseerd op het principe van sequentiële uitvoering van wiskundige bewerkingen. Hierdoor is er behoefte aan opstellen van programma's in de aangegeven volgorde uitvoeren van een specifieke actie sequenties. Aangezien het programma groot en omvangrijk kan zijn, is een specialist vaak geconfronteerd met de noodzaak van grafische (visuele) het opstellen van een werkplan - het algoritme.

Algoritme - is duidelijk in absoluut record volgorde om wiskundige bewerkingen nodig zijn om de taken van de computer te bereiken uit te voeren. Men kan er ook rekening mee dat het een opeenvolging van incrementele toepassing van de oorspronkelijke invoergegevens voor het eindresultaat. Het feit dat elk programma een reeks handelingen: Gebruikersonderzoek (initiële gegevensinvoer), voert de gespecificeerde acties de gegevensuitvoer resultaat.

Blok begin en einde van het algoritme in het schema weergegeven als een ovaal en heeft een ingang en een uitgang, respectievelijk. Blokken van gegevensinvoer en -uitvoer - in de vorm van een parallellogram. Blokken wiskundige bewerkingen zijn afgebeeld als rechthoeken en ook een ingang en een uitgang.

Een eenvoudige (basis) beschrijving van het type actie een lineair algoritme. Dit soort visueel beeld van het programma dat wordt uitgevoerd als een single-step omzetting van externe gegevens van opgenomen in het eindresultaat en vervolgens uitvoeren van visuele apparaten. De lineaire algoritme voor elke volgende bewerking of actie begint strikt worden uitgevoerd na de voorgaande handeling of werking.

Vaak is het nodig om de gegevens te controleren voor de naleving van alle omstandigheden. En afhankelijk van het resultaat moet je een bepaalde actie uit te voeren. Het is niet moeilijk te raden dat het programma zal worden beschreven met de hulp van andere rassen van het algoritme - vertakt.

Vertakking algoritme - een beschrijving van een vooraf bepaalde reeks handelingen, waaronder het controleren van de gegevens inachtneming van een vooraf bepaalde voorwaarde. Het resultaat van deze test kan hetzij gescande gegevens overeenkomen met de gespecificeerde aandoening of afwijking. En afhankelijk van de resultaten, doe één verdere reeks handelingen, of andere.

de verificatie-eenheid is weergegeven in de vorm van een ruit met één ingang en twee uitgangen, overeenkomend met de positieve of negatieve controle kanaal.

In de regel kan de eenvoudigste taken worden weergegeven als een klein blok diagram. Maar als de taak wordt geleverd aan de programmeur groot genoeg is, de beelden op papier (monitor) het algoritme kan een lastige monster geworden. Ter vereenvoudiging visueel beeld workflow ondersteunende structuren worden gebruikt.

De extra algoritme - een deel van het programma waarin de specifieke, vooraf bepaalde volgorde van handelingen los opgelegd het basisalgoritme en ontworpen te vereenvoudigen, vermindering van de aanvankelijke grootte hiervan. Dit fragment kan elk aantal malen worden gebruikt in strikte inachtneming van de invoergegevens.

hulpstoffen algoritme weergegeven in blokschemavorm een rechthoek met de gebruikelijke beschrijving, die een plaats waar een beeld van het apparaat een schema dat wordt beschreven voorbeeld.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 birmiss.com. Theme powered by WordPress.